Google Chrome is a freeware web browser developed by Google. It used to have WebKit layout engine until the version 27 with the exception of its iOS release. If you’ve tried to install Google Chrome Browser in Ubuntu, then you may have noticed that it’s not available in the Ubuntu Software Center. However, it’s easy to download a package file for Google Chrome and install it on your system through terminal. Atom is a free and open-source text and source code editor for OS X, Linux, and Windows with support for plug-ins written in Node.js, and embedded Git Control, developed by GitHub. Atom is a desktop application built using web technologies. Most of the extended packages have free software licenses and are community-built and maintained. It is having a simple and intuitive graphical user interface and a bunch of interesting features for writing − CSS, HTML, JavaScript and other web programming languages.
